Fruits possess different arrangements of seeds inside their bulk depending on their mode of seed dispersal. The variety of shapes and characteristics of fruits reflect how they are dispersed. Some fruits are wind-dispersed and have lightweight structures or wing-like appendages to be carried by the wind. Others are dispersed by animals and have features like attractive colors, scents, or burrs and hooks to cling to fur.
